1.2.1 输入语句、输出语句和赋值语句学习目标 1.了解算法输入语句、输出语句和赋值语句语句 2.掌握正确的语句格式重点难点:基本语句及其一般格式方 法:自主学习 合作探究 师生互动一知识衔接1.算法的概念算法通常是指按照一定规则解决某一类问题的明确和有限的_______.现在,算法通常可以编写成计算机程序,让计算机执行并解决问题.2.几个基本程序框及其功能(略)3.执行如下图所示的程序框图,若输入 A 的值为 2,则输出的 P 值为( ) 二自主预习1.输入语句课 堂 随笔:12.输出语句3.赋值语句4.几种常见的运算符号及函数符号编写程序时,有些符号与我们平常使用的符号不一样,下面是常用的数学符号与程序符号的对照表:2三典例分析例 1(1)下列输入语句书写正确的是( )A.INPUT“A,B,C=”a,b,c B.INPUT“A,B,C=”;a,b,cC.INPUTa,b,c=;“A,B,C” D.PRINT“A,B,C=”;a,b,c(2)下列输出语句书写不正确的是( )A.PRINT S B.PRINT S=4C.PRINT “S=”;S D.PRINT (a+b+c)/3(3)下列语句书写正确的是________(只填序号).①INPUT x=3 ②INPUT a,b,c ③PRINT a,b,c④A=B=C=3 ⑤i=i+1例 2 阅读下列程序,并回答问题.(1)中若输入 1,2,则输出的结果为________;(2)中若输入 3,2,5,则输出的结果为________.例 3 若将两个数 a=8,b=17 交换,使 a=17,b=8.下面语句正确的一组是( ) 后 记 与感悟: 3 跟踪训练1 下列输入语句正确的是( )A.INPUT 2,3,4 B.INPUT “x=”;x,“y=”;yC.INPUT x,y,z D.INPUT x=22 下面的语句执行后输出的结果为________;A=2,B=3B=A*AA=A+BB=B+APRINT A,BRND3 已知程序若输入 a,b,c 的值分别为 1,2,3,则输出 a,b,c 的值分别为________.四、当 堂 检 测: 1.下列输入语句正确的是( )A.INPUT “a;b” B.INPUT “x=”,xC.INPUT a·b D.INPUT “x=”;x 2.下列给出的输入、输出语句正确的是( )① 输入语句:INPUT a,b,c,d,e ② 输入语句:INPUT X=1③ 输出语句:PRINT A=4 ④ 输出语句:PRINT 10,3*2,2/34A. ①② B.②③ C.③④D.①④ 3.下列赋值语句正确的是( )4.下列所给的运算结果正确的个数为 附答案 例 1: B 例 2:(1)1,-2,-1 (2)-3 例 3: B 跟踪训练 1: C 2: 6 , 10 3: 3,1,2当 堂 检 测:1:D 2:D 3: C 4:45